D. Swartzendruber is a scholar working on Civil and Structural Engineering, Environmental Engineering and Soil Science. According to data from OpenAlex, D. Swartzendruber has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 44 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ering, 31 papers in Environmental Engineering and 11 papers in Soil Science. Recurrent topics in D. Swartzendruber's work include Soil and Unsaturated Flow (39 papers), Groundwater flow and contamination studies (28 papers) and Dam Engineering and Safety (6 papers). D. Swartzendruber is often cited by papers focused on Soil and Unsaturated Flow (39 papers), Groundwater flow and contamination studies (28 papers) and Dam Engineering and Safety (6 papers). D. Swartzendruber collaborates with scholars based in United States, Brazil and China. D. Swartzendruber's co-authors include L. R. Ahuja, T. C. Olson, E.G. Youngs, D. L. Nofziger, L. N. Mielke, M. Fuchs, A. Hadas, P.E. Rijtema, D. A. Russell and Bruno Yaron and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res, Journal of Applied Physics and Water Resources Research.
